Lemongrass is a perennial that can thrive in tropical climates. It can grow between 0.8 and 1m in height and has long, narrow leaves with rough sides. The leaves are citrus-like in scent. The stems and the rhizomes are either white or purple. The leaves and rhizomes of lemongrass are utilized to make essential oils. Citral is the principal ingredient in the lemongrass essential oil. Citral has anti-bacterial, anti-inflammatory and antifungal properties.

Bad breath can be caused by drugs

Bad breath can be a side effect of some medication. Certain antibiotics, for instance may cause bad breath. Bad breath can be caused by other medications like medications that decrease saliva production or release chemicals into the air. Bad breath could also be caused by tranquilizers, antidepressants, and certain vitamins supplements. Sometimes, halitosis could be caused by foreign objects in the mouth and nose.

Bad breath can be caused by a variety of substances, including alcohol and recreational drugs. People who smoke marijuana could also experience bad breath. In addition, those who consume methamphetamine may have bad breath, just like those who are exposed to radiation. Proper hydration and hygiene can reduce bad breath caused by these medications.

In addition to the bacteria in the mouth, the odor-causing bacteria may also be caused by certain medications. These medications can cause dry mouth and bad odor by reducing the flow of saliva. Some of the most commonly used drugs that cause bad breath are antihistamines, decongestants, diuretics and blood pressure medications.
